Pervasive Grids with Autonomic Capabilities. A grid computing system that brings together a multitude of heterogonous resources able should be able to function continuously without much intervention by a human operator. This work aims at developing techniques and tools for the monitoring and prediction of the behaviour of the core structure of a grid. In this case, the ?core? structure is a large- or a wide-area network, or a collection of such networks. The monitoring process will feed into the other layers in the grid fabric important information (traffic, current and possible future congestions, failures, topological variations, etc) to enable the efficient and consistent operation of the grid. This is an important research problem in grid computing
since traditional assumptions that are more or less valid in conventional high-performance computing settings break down on the Grid.Read moreRead less

Expressiveness Comparison and Interchange Facilitation between Business Process Execution Languages. Developments in the area of business process management are currently hindered by the plethora of diverse business process execution languages. This project will develop techniques for dealing with interoperability issues induced by this language heterogeneity. The project combines theoretical research, grounded in concurrency theory and workflow patterns, with pragmatic research focusing on languages supported by commercial tools. The outcome will be a framework for comparing the expressiveness of process execution languages and defining mappings between them. This will place Australia at the forefront of developments in business process management systems: a crucial technology in today's global, dynamic, and heterogeneous environments.

This project will advance the fundamental underst ....Personalized, Adaptive, and Semantic-driven Selection and Composition of Web Services. Web services are the pillar of the new generation of Internet technologies. They provide standardized access to functionality that would otherwise be hidden inside enterprise information systems. As the existing base of web services expands, there is a need for techniques to select, configure, assemble, and coordinate web services to perform complex user tasks. This project will advance the fundamental understanding and know-how in this area by addressing three complementary research challenges: how to, organize and search semantically rich service descriptions; select services with respect to flexible and personalized criteria; and coordinate services in an adaptive and context-aware manner.Read moreRead less
